Charingworth Manor has appointed Colin Heaney as new GM

Published on : Thursday, May 17, 2018

 

 

He first managed the Charingworth Manor when it was under the ownership of English Rose Hotels in 1995.

 

 

Colin Heaney has most recently been working for Peter de Savary’s hotel operations across the South of England.

 

 

Prior to that, he spent two and a half years at the Lygon Arms in Broadway, and eight years at the Bear Hotel in Hungerford before it was sold to Greene King. He was also General Manager of Wyck Hill House in Stow on the Wold for eight years.

 

 

His aim is to further establish Charingworth Manor at the heart of the community. He explained that over the weeks they will be getting involved in more local events to support local people.

 

 

Richard Grime, Managing Director of Classic Lodges, says Colin has spent much of his working life in and around the Cotswolds so knows the area exceptionally well, After Michael Eastick’s retirement following many years of fantastic service, the hotel wanted to appoint someone who was going to continue his excellent work within the community.
